cordova courir avec ios erreur .. code d'Erreur 65 de commande: xcodebuild avec args:
Ce erreur se produit uniquement quand j'essaie de cordova run ios --device
Même après cordova build ios
commande exécutée, non erreur est signalée.
Quoi je fais de mal? Et comment déboguer cordova projets sur mon iPhone (besoin de cette raison de la nécessité de tester une fonction Appareil photo)
WITH CONFIGURATION Debug ===
Check dependencies
Code Sign error: No provisioning profiles found: No non–expired provisioning profiles were found.
** BUILD FAILED **
The following build commands failed:
Check dependencies
(1 failure)
Error code 65 for command: xcodebuild with args: -xcconfig,/Users/ridermansb/Projects/jdapp/platforms/ios/cordova/build-debug.xcconfig,-project,CorrijaMe.xcodeproj,ARCHS=armv7 armv7s arm64,-target,CorrijaMe,-configuration,Debug,-sdk,iphoneos,build,VALID_ARCHS=armv7 armv7s arm64,CONFIGURATION_BUILD_DIR=/Users/ridermansb/Projects/jdapp/platforms/ios/build/device,SHARED_PRECOMPS_DIR=/Users/ridermansb/Projects/jdapp/platforms/ios/build/sharedpch
ERROR running one or more of the platforms: Error: /Users/ridermansb/Projects/jdapp/platforms/ios/cordova/run: Command failed with exit code 2
You may not have the required environment or OS to run this project
- Voici la solution les gars !!! stackoverflow.com/questions/36095819/...
Vous devez vous connecter pour publier un commentaire.
Vous avez besoin d'un profil d'approvisionnement de développement sur votre machine de compilation. Les applications peuvent s'exécuter sur le simulateur, sans un profil, mais ils sont requis pour exécuter sur un périphérique réel.
Si vous ouvrez le projet dans Xcode, il peut configurer automatiquement la mise en service pour vous. Sinon, vous devrez créer aller à l'iOS Dev Center et créer un profil.
Essayez de supprimer et d'ajouter ios nouveau
Travaillé dans mon cas
Remplacer ionique avec cordova le cas échéant.
J'ai eu le même problème. Dans mon cas,
cordova platform update ios
aidé. La raison en est dans version obsolète.platform remove ios
etplatform add ios
cordova platform update android||ios
n'est plus supporté. Ce que vous devez fairecordova platform remove android||ios
puiscordova platform add android||ios
J'avais la même erreur quand j'ai essayé de faire :
cordova build ios
sauf le mien dit ** l'ARCHIVAGE ÉCHOUÉ ** au lieu de ** BUILD FAILED **.
Je l'ai fixée par l'ouverture de la projectName.xcodeproj fichier dans Xcode, puis le réglage de ces 2 paramètres :
Ensuite j'ai cessé de Xcode et rediffusé
cordova build ios
et cela a fonctionné.Archive failed
signifie qu'il est une signature liée problème c'est à dire pas de profil de configuration. Ouvert Xcode et de choisir une équipe et de Xcode va générer/trouver un profil de configuration pour vous.Ouvrez xCode peut être épuisant si vous le faites à chaque fois, vous devez ajouter ce drapeau :
OU si vous avez à construire.fichier json à la racine de votre projet, vous devez ajouter ces lignes:
Espère que cela aidera à l'avenir
J'ai essayé un peu de choses dans ce scénario.
J'ai enlevé ios et installé à de nombreuses reprises. Descendit le chemin de la suppression d'écrans de démarrage en vain! Bitcode on/off à de nombreuses reprises.
Cependant, après la sélection d'un iOS provisioning de l'équipe, et en cours d'exécution
pod update
à l'intérieur de./platforms/ios
, je suis heureux de vous annoncer que cet résolu mes problèmes.J'espère que vous pouvez essayer la même chose et d'obtenir une résolution?
Dans mon cas, c'était l'icône de l'application fichier PNG... je veux dire, il a fallu 1 journée pour aller à partir de la condition d'erreur
à l'lisible par l'homme, un:
Je dois ajouter :
J'ai eu le même problème, cela venait du fait que mon coéquipier avait une version différente de cordoue, et engage des plugins sur le repo avec sa version.
Pour tous les plugins cordova, j'ai dû :
Et demander à mon coéquipier pour mettre à jour son cordova pour correspondre à ma version
Comment faire ce que @connor a dit:
iOS
platforms/ios
sur XCodeio.ionic.starter
dans tous les fichiers d'un identifiant uniqueionic cordova run ios --device --livereload
1) du code Ouvert dans Xcode
2) Continuer avec :
ionic cordova build ios